Running on Rice... Cookers

I’m sure many of you have heard of rice cookers. Great. So what, they cook rice. Why would someone want to talk about a home appliance that only cooks rice? Better yet, why are rice cookers perfect for runners who want to eat healthy? Here is a rice cooker that can help with healthy living. But, what does it do? A lot. Here are four reasons to own one:
                                            

1. Cook your favorite meats or proteins!

Meat? Yes. Really. This rice cooker has the capacity to cook chicken, beef, fish, eggs and more. This device has the ability to either use the slow cook, smart steam, or the quick rice functions to cook your favorite proteins from their raw state. This is not a joke. It’s the real deal!

2. Cook your favorite carbohydrates and other foods, not just rice!

Rice, pasta, beans, vegetables, quinoa, potatoes, and mostly anything else one could think of. The smart steam and quick rice functions allow this appliance to steam your vegetables perfectly using the smart steam tray inside, or cook your pasta, quinoa or beans just the way you like it.

3. Reheat any food previously cooked!

This speaks for itself, but the ability for runners to reheat their favorite meals is a must in our busy lives.

4. Has a delay timer that can have your food cooked right after your run!

Not many of us have our own cooks at home where our food can be cooked and ready to go right when we come back from a long run or hard workout. Sounds like a big problem right? This device is the solution. It’s simple to use. All you do is set the time you want it to start cooking and it has your food ready for you right when you want it. It’s like your own personal chef.

With the ability to cook almost anything imaginable, this becomes an appliance any runner could use. For full recipes, or a little further inspiration to check out Aroma’s recipe booklet!
